Vale – Michael Richardson

The Australian Property Institute and the broader valuation community are deeply saddened by the passing of Michael Cameron Richardson (10 April 1977 – 1 February 2025). At just 47 years old, Mike’s life was one filled with warmth, dedication and an unwavering passion for his profession.
Mike, as he was fondly known, was born in Forster and educated at The Armidale School in NSW. He built a respected career as a real estate agent and valuer – work he truly loved and excelled in. After completing his Advanced Diploma of Property Valuation at TAFE in 2006, he joined the API in March 2008, achieving AAPI membership status a year later. In 2012, he proudly attained his CPV and spent the rest of his working career with Duponts, MVS and Propell in Newcastle and then Herron Todd White in Forster and surrounding areas, earning the admiration and respect of colleagues and clients alike.
Beyond his professional achievements, Mike was a man with a big heart, great sense of humour and unrivalled generosity. A proud son of Molly and Don and a beloved brother to Donna, Sharon and Scott, he filled the lives of those around him with laughter and fun, with his true larrikin spirit. He cherished good company, valued his friendships deeply and never missed an opportunity to bring people together.
Mike’s presence will be profoundly missed by his family, friends, colleagues and all who had the privilege of knowing him, along with his loyal companion, Clancy the Dog.
Rest peacefully Mike, you will always be remembered.
